Starting an organizing project

When you are starting an organizing project, it is just as important to ask "What is working?" as it is to ask "What is not working?."  

For inspiration on how to fix problems, model solutions after what IS working.  An example of what to look for might be to notice whether items behind closed cabinets tend to stay more organized or those in open top bins on shelves.
